...Guy's, I have a general question regarding material cost increases with new construction.
I'm having a 40' x 50' outbuilding constructed on my property, and now in dispute with my General Contractor regarding his request for additional fees due to material cost increases within a 15 month period between the Contract signing and actual commencement of work. He claims both concrete and lumber costs significantly increased over this time frame, especially with Hurricane Irma activity through the State. I have yet to confirm any material cost increases with local supply houses.
I was quite surprised when this was presented to me. It appears he's trying to squeeze me, maybe because his profit margin isn't as high as he planned.
Since there is no language within the Contract pertaining to additional fees assessed for this specific issue, he obviously is legally bound to fulfill all services for the agreed price.
I never hired a GC before, therefore, my question is if this request is something common out there, especially with smaller General Contractors?
